About 3-[1-[[1-(2,6-dimethylphenyl)tetrazol-5-yl]-[2-(trifluoromethoxy)phenyl]methyl]piperidin-4-yl]-1H-benzimidazol-2-one

3-[1-[[1-(2,6-dimethylphenyl)tetrazol-5-yl]-[2-(trifluoromethoxy)phenyl]methyl]piperidin-4-yl]-1H-benzimidazol-2-one (PubChem CID 51360327) has the molecular formula C29H28F3N7O2 and a molecular weight of 563.58 g/mol. Its IUPAC name is 3-[1-[[1-(2,6-dimethylphenyl)tetrazol-5-yl]-[2-(trifluoromethoxy)phenyl]methyl]piperidin-4-yl]-1H-benzimidazol-2-one.
